Thranduil picked up the Elfling and balanced him in the crook of his elbow.

"Greenleaf, Ada has some visitors from Imladris."

Legolas stared at him with bright blue eyes that held no worries. He tilted his head slightly and reached forwards to grab Thranduil's nose.

"Ai! Legolas! That's Ada's nose!"

"Trouble with the Elfling, Thranduil?"

Thranduil spun round to see who dare to address their King in such a disrespectful way and found himself face to face with Lord Elrond who was watching the Prince's antics with an amused expression.

"Aye, I guess you could say that..."

"May I?" Thranduil nodded and Elrond took Legolas in his own arms. "They are so innocent at this age... He will grow up to achieve great feats. You should be proud to have such a fine son, mellon-nin."

"I should be? I am, just as any father should be proud of their child." Thranduil gently traced circles on Legolas's palm, staring adoringly at his face.

"You have changed." Elrond stated, smiling slightly at the doting father.

"Would this child not change any father? Can you say Ada, my leaf?"

"Ada!" Legolas put out his arms and opened his hands. "Ada!"

Elrond laughed at Thranduil's face and placed the Prince back in his father's arms. "I think he wants his ada."

"Ada!" Legolas confirmed, clapping his hands together.

Thranduil smiled and used the ends of his long blonde hair to tease Legolas. The Prince wrinkled his nose and grabbed a handful of the hair, pulling on it.

"Ai!" The King gasped and leaned his head towards his son, trying to lessen the pain. "Ah!"

"Thrandy," The Queen Faerverenel glided elegantly down the staircase towards her son and husband. "You have a lot to learn about being a father."

Faerverenel glanced at Legolas who was not pulling his father's hair anymore and wrapped an arm around her husband's shoulders. She winked at Elrond who had noticed the same thing as her and tucked a few strands of loose hair behind her pointed ears.

"And the first thing you need to learn, is that hair is not a suitable meal for young Elflings."

"What?" He looked down at his son and gasped. "Legolas! That's Ada's hair!"
